Sole trader VAT exempt

Hi,

I’ve opened as seller account as a Sole trader and filled out the required documents. Include registering as sole trader/UTR number, I also attached my letter from HMRC with UTR details. But when trying to register as VAT exempt, I have been asked for additional information.

Amazon have asked for Certificate of Incorporation or a copy of a previously filed tax return proving Sole trader status.

As I am new business starter have not field any tax return yet. It would be in January 2015.

How would I provide these as a new seller? I checked online that HMRC UK do not provide any certificate proving my status as a Sole trader. They just provided UTR letter post submitting self assessment application.

Any advice is appreciated.

Thanks!

You are aware that being vat exempt as a sole trader just makes you exempt from the VAT on the seller fees. You still need to pay VAT on advertising costs etc.

Is that a typo 2015, or have you not done any tax returns since starting in 2015?? I would be concerned if the was the case...

As a sole-trader, and if you are under the VAT threshold, you can declare your VAT exempt status by going to Settings (cog wheel top right) and Tax Settings from the dropdown.

As above reply it only exempts you fro VAT on seller fees.

Am not sure where you live - ?UK, but if you do not live in UK and store goods in UK warehouses for FBA then you must be VAT registered as you are classed as a NETP.
